IMPLEMENTATION
The Athlete Development Blueprint is not a template. Coaches must identify where an athlete sits
within the model through assessments, consultations, and empirical data.
Mixed Modal provides the principles and tools needed to personalize the Athlete Development
Blueprint and implement each concept.

Each developmental phase is not an exact science and will fluctuate based on individual biology
and outside factors. Understanding how to identify where an athlete currently is will allow for
optimization of each training session.
